The Wheeler-DeWitt equation for the Brans-Dicke's theory of gravitation
is solved by two boundary condition proposals of Hartle-Hawking ("no
boundary") and Vilenkin ("tunneling from nothing"). It is found that all
classical expanding trajectories begin on the classical-quantum boundary
and the effective cosmological constant is very small.
